Empirical Bayes Likelihood for Exponential Distribution Family under Ranked Set Sampling and Dependent Data

Ranked set sampling, empirical Bayes likelihood, Exponential distribution.Abstract
In this paper, we get the empirical Bayes likelihood test rules for Exponential distribution based on ranked set sampling. Its asymptotic optimality is obtained. Due to the advantages of combining empirical Bayesian methods with prior information of samples, the accuracy of statistical inference can be improved. Therefore, the fusion of empirical Bayesian likelihood methods can further enhance the estimation methods of statistical models.
